I spent a significant chunk of this afternoon being paid to try on underwear. In front of other women, who then bought me said underwear. This was a lot more fun than any women reading might think, and a LOT less interesting than any men reading are thinking...

I was with the costume designer for my forthcoming operetta, and one of the costume assistants. I am immensely proud of myself for having got through the entire afternoon in German, notwithstanding one slightly awkward moment (third layer of corsetry; shop lady asks how I feel; I aim for levity, as in "like a turkey trussed up for Christmas". Their faces show that I haven't quite hit my mark. I am hoping that Pute, which is what I was aiming at in German for turkey, does not have a secondary meaning aligned to Pute in French, which, meaning prostitute, could conceivably mean I just cheerfully labelled myself a bondage whore... Might explain why they were a little silent for a while!!).
